Overview

Chloride process titanium dioxide (TiO2) is a premium white pigment produced via the chloride method, which involves chlorinating titanium ore and oxidizing the resulting titanium tetrachloride. This method yields a product with higher purity and better optical properties compared to the sulfate process. TiO2 is renowned for its brightness, opacity, and durability, making it indispensable in industries requiring high-performance pigments. The chloride process is favored for its environmental advantages, as it generates fewer byproducts and consumes less energy. The resulting TiO2 is primarily in the rutile crystalline form, which offers superior weather resistance and UV stability. This makes it ideal for outdoor applications such as architectural coatings and automotive paints.

Physical and Chemical Properties

Chloride process TiO2 exhibits a high refractive index (2.7 for rutile), which contributes to its exceptional opacity and hiding power. It is chemically inert, resistant to acids, alkalis, and solvents, and thermally stable up to 1800°C. The powder is typically fine-grained, with particle sizes ranging from 0.2 to 0.3 microns, optimized for light scattering. Its insolubility in water and organic solvents ensures longevity in formulated products. The surface of TiO2 particles is often treated with inorganic or organic coatings (e.g., silica, alumina) to enhance dispersibility and compatibility with different matrices, such as polymer systems in plastics or binders in paints.

Main Applications

The primary use of chloride process TiO2 is in paints and coatings, where it provides whiteness, gloss, and protection against UV degradation. It is a key component in high-end architectural paints, automotive finishes, and industrial coatings. In plastics, it improves opacity and color stability for products like PVC window profiles and food packaging. Other applications include paper (as a filler and coating agent), cosmetics (sunscreens due to UV absorption), and ceramics (glaze opacifier). Its non-toxicity allows for use in food-contact materials and pharmaceuticals, subject to regulatory compliance.

Safety and Storage

While TiO2 is generally considered non-toxic, inhalation of fine dust may cause respiratory irritation. Proper personal protective equipment (PPE), such as masks and gloves, is recommended during handling. The powder should be stored in sealed containers to prevent moisture absorption, which can affect dispersibility. Regulatory classifications vary; some jurisdictions classify certain TiO2 forms as potential carcinogens (e.g., EU Category 2 inhalation hazard). Always consult Safety Data Sheets (SDS) and local regulations. Spills should be cleaned with dry methods to avoid dust generation.

B2B Procurement Guide

When procuring chloride process TiO2, prioritize suppliers with ISO certifications and consistent quality control. Key specifications to verify include purity (≥98% TiO2), particle size distribution (measured via laser diffraction), and surface treatment type (e.g., alumina for paint compatibility). Bulk purchases (20+ metric tons) often qualify for discounts. Consider regional logistics—China and North America are major production hubs. Sample testing is advised to confirm performance in your specific application. Long-term contracts may hedge against price volatility linked to titanium ore and energy costs.
